Evidence-based approaches and online care

Ashley draws on evidence-based therapeutic techniques that focus on awareness and skill building. One common technique involves identifying patterns that maintain anxiety or disordered eating, then practicing small behavior changes to shift those patterns. This work helps people notice triggers and choose different responses.

Another approach centers on mood regulation skills. That includes learning practical tools to manage stress and strong emotions, like grounding exercises, paced breathing, and stepwise exposure to uncomfortable situations. These methods aim to reduce overwhelm and increase confidence in handling daily challenges.

Finding the right approach is part of the process. Ashley partners with each person to test methods that fit their needs, goals, and preferences. Together they track what helps and adjust the plan so therapy stays relevant and useful.

Online therapy options include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ging. Video works well for face-to-face conversation and visual cues. Phone sessions can be a simpler option when bandwidth is limited or for a shorter check-in. Live chat and text messaging allow ongoing support between sessions and fit into busy schedules. These formats make it easier to arrange consistent care around work, school, and family life.
